The Efficiency of Electric Sprayers
The advent of electric sprayers has brought a significant shift in the way farmers approach pest control and crop management. Traditional methods often involve cumbersome equipment and the use of fossil fuels, which can be inefficient and harmful to the environment. Electric sprayers, on the other hand, utilize battery power to operate, offering a more sustainable alternative that reduces carbon emissions and reliance on non-renewable energy sources.
Furthermore, electric sprayers provide precision application, allowing farmers to target specific areas with minimal waste. This efficiency not only conserves resources such as water and pesticides but also minimizes chemical runoff into surrounding ecosystems. By accurately delivering inputs where they are needed most, electric sprayers help maintain soil health and promote biodiversity.
Enhanced User Experience and Safety
One of the standout features of electric sprayers is their ease of use. Unlike traditional gas-powered models, electric sprayers are generally lighter and quieter, making them more user-friendly for farmers. The ergonomic designs often include adjustable nozzles and user-friendly controls, allowing operators to customize spray patterns and flow rates with ease.
Safety is another critical advantage of electric sprayers. With reduced exposure to harmful fumes and chemicals, farmers can work more comfortably and healthily. This is particularly beneficial in organic farming practices, where maintaining a clean and safe environment is paramount. The lower noise levels also contribute to a less stressful working atmosphere, enhancing overall productivity on the farm.
